Basics of the game's seasonal system

Fundamental feature Forza Horizon 4 is cyclical. The game divides the year into four stages: spring, summer, autumn and winter. Each season lasts exactly one week in real time. On Thursday at 14:30 GMT (or at the appropriate time in your local time), an automatic update occurs and the game world is transformed.

Dynamic weather affects not only the visual component, but also the physics of the car. In summer, the tracks are dry and provide maximum traction, while in autumn the roads become slippery due to rain and fallen leaves. In winter, many bodies of water freeze, opening up new paths, while dirt roads turn into dangerous icy tracks.

⚠️ Attention: In Horizon Life online mode, all players on the server are in the same season. You will not be able to change the season for yourself if you are in a shared world with other racers.

Season change in single player mode

If you want full control over the weather, you'll need to switch to single player mode. This allows you to ignore the global server loop and manually select a season at any time. To do this, open the pause menu, go to the “Menu” tab and select the “Find a new game” or “Change game mode” option.

In the list that appears, select the “Single Player” option. After loading, you will find yourself in an isolated world where time will be stopped the moment you exit online mode, or you can select a specific season when creating a session. In this mode manual season change becomes available through the main menu.

To change the season, press the menu button, go to the “Settings” section and find the “Season” item. Here you will see four icons corresponding to the seasons. By selecting the one you need, you will instantly be transported to the selected period. This is the ideal way to perform specific tasks, such as drifting on ice or high-speed racing on a dry track.

It is important to note that in single player mode, progress in seasonal challenges (Seasonal Playlist) is also saved, but it is updated only when the server season changes. However, you can take these challenges in any weather you choose, making life much easier for newbies.

Horizon Life Online Mode Limitations

Horizon Life mode is designed for social interaction and cooperative races. To ensure equal conditions for all participants, the developers synchronized the seasons for all players on the server. This means that if it is summer on the server, then you, your friend, and the random racer who overtook you on the track will have sunny weather.

Trying to change the season in this mode will get you nowhere. The season selection menu will be unavailable or blocked. The only way to influence the situation is to wait for the natural change of the week or switch to a different mode. Server synchronization - this is a strict limitation that cannot be circumvented without going into a single player game.

However, the online mode offers its advantages. When the season changes (usually on Thursday), live events are held, new Season Series routes are unlocked, and unique cars become available as rewards for completing weekly challenges.

The influence of the season on physics and tracks

Change of seasons in Forza Horizon 4 - this is not just a cosmetic effect. This is a profound mechanical feature that changes the way you approach racing. In winter, for example, lakes and rivers freeze, which opens up access to new racing tracks laid directly on the ice. In summer, these same areas are water that is impossible to drive through.

Spring and autumn bring their own adjustments. Spring mud after the snow melts reduces traction on dirt sections, turning rally tracks into slippery ordeals. In autumn, fallen leaves on the asphalt act as a lubricant, requiring the player to be more careful when turning.

Secret locations in winter

Winter unlocks several secret bonus boards and fast routes that are physically inaccessible at other times of the year due to water or tall grass. Be sure to explore the map in December-January.

For professional players, knowing the physics of each season is critical. The selection of tires (if the appropriate setting of the assistants or in simulator mode is used) and the suspension settings must take into account the temperature of the road surface. Winter tires (in the context of difficulty settings) or just careful throttle work is necessary to win winter races.

In addition, some cars perform better in outdoor conditions. Powerful all-wheel drive monsters are indispensable in the snow, while lightweight rear-wheel drive roadsters perform best on dry summer asphalt.

Seasonal Challenges and Rewards

Each week, the game offers players a new set of challenges known as the Seasonal Playlist. To access the full list of rewards, you must achieve a certain number of PRs in each of the four types of events: road racing, cross-country racing, drifting and speed stages.

Completing these tasks allows you to receive new cars, items of clothing, horns (signals) and emotes (emotions) as a reward. The most valuable prizes, including exclusive cars, are usually available for 20,000 PR at the end of the season.

⚠️ Attention: If you do not manage to complete the seasonal playlist before the week changes, your progress bars will burn out and you will only receive consolation prizes. Hurry up to claim your reward before Thursday!

Frequently asked questions (FAQ)

Is it possible to change the season online with friends?

No, in Co-op mode or in the open world of Horizon Life, the season is determined by the server and is the same for everyone. To change the season, the session host needs to go to the main menu and switch to the “Single Player” mode, and then invite friends again, but then it will no longer be a standard online mode, but a private session with manual settings.

How often do seasons change in Forza Horizon 4?

The season change occurs strictly once a week in real time. The update always happens on Thursday at 14:30 Greenwich Time (GMT). Depending on your time zone, it could be a Thursday afternoon, evening, or even night.

What happens if I don't play for a whole week?

If you miss a week, you simply won't receive the missed seasonal playlist reward. When you enter the game, there will already be a new season there. PR points do not accumulate while you are offline. However, you can always play Single Player and select any season to complete old quests if they are still in the archive, but you will only receive weekly rewards for the current week for the current server season.

Does the change of season affect car sales?

The change of season does not have a direct impact on the auction (Auction House). Prices are determined by the supply and demand of players. However, indirectly, demand may increase for cars that are ideal for the current season (for example, rally cars in winter), which may temporarily increase their value.

Is it possible to turn off the change of seasons completely?

In Horizon Life mode, you cannot disable the change of seasons, as this is the core mechanic of the game. In Single Player mode, you can simply choose not to change the season manually, and the season will remain locked to your chosen value until you change it yourself.
